The best free apps for guitar ๐ŸŽธ๐Ÿ“ฑ

1. ๐ŸŽฏ GuitarTuna รฉ Professional Tuner + Games

After trying dozens of apps, GuitarTuna it is positioned as one of the most complete on the market. Although it is mainly known as a tuner, it offers much more.

What does it offer?

  • Precise and easy-to-use guitar tuner (with cell phone microphone)
  • Mode to tune other instruments: bass, ukulele, banjo
  • Hearing training games
  • Library with more than 100 chords and exercises
  • Quick lessons for beginners

๐ŸŒŸ Ideal for those who are just starting out and need a reliable ally to tune and practice daily.

2. ๐Ÿ“š Yousician รฉs Your personal music teacher

Yousician it is a multi-award-winning app that works as a virtual tutor. It is available for guitar, piano, singing and more. Its free version allows limited but very effective daily training.

Featured advantages:

  • Structured classes in the form of a game ๐ŸŽฎ
  • Real-time note detection with the microphone
  • Instructional videos, challenges and weekly objectives
  • Rewards and levels system (very motivating)
  • Compatible with electric and acoustic guitars

If you like to learn by playing, this app is perfect for you. Plus, you don't need any additional cables or equipment, just your cell phone and guitar.

3. ๐ŸŽต Justin Guitar 3 Classes of the famous YouTuber

Justin Sandercoe he is one of the best-known guitar teachers on the internet, and his free app reflects all his experience and charisma.

What it includes:

  • More than 1,000 guitar lessons for all levels
  • Explanatory videos recorded by Justin
  • Famous songs to play with simplified chords
  • Rhythm exercises, technique, music theory and more
  • Daily guided practice programs

In addition, it has a very active community where you can share your progress, doubts and achievements. A complete and very friendly experience! ๐Ÿง‘โ€๐ŸŽค
